Chrysalis Community Activities - Building Based
Chrysalis is a local organisation that works with passion and integrity, for over 30 years supporting adults with disabilities (specialising in learning disability) to live active, exciting and independent lives.
Based in North Cumbria, we deliver group, individual and intensive support.
In partnership, we develop individual support plans promoting independence enabling you to access a range of activities, community resources, training and employment opportunities.
We offer a range of community activities and independent living skills including , personal care, relationships/sexuality, cookery, literacy and numeracy, sensory stimulation, walking (including fell walking in the lakes), sailing, swimming, independent travel, music and drama, pottery, gardening, woodwork etc from our two specialist resource bases. Pre-employment training and work placements are provided including our own Wholefood shop and weekly lunch offer at a community café.
We also support individuals to access a wide range of community activities in town and villages across Allerdale through our outreach provision.
Activities are flexible, however core provision for activities at resource bases form structured sessions 9am-12 lunch support and 1pm-3pm session.
Support outside of these hours and at evenings and weekends is available.
Although based in Wigton, individuals are welcome to attend from areas across Cumbria at these bases.
